Output 435520c59d6d4a5cd560692e1849ca07de1d0024b002e7b83334eb65889e2312:0

value
21700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ed6ad14e85784606ccad6e75d42b53c0dcd76015 OP_EQUAL
address
3PLN2pnyoLJpVFX5ST4f6NX7kvJ1zSfgcR
transaction
435520c59d6d4a5cd560692e1849ca07de1d0024b002e7b83334eb65889e2312
spent
true